Entdecken Sie Dubrovniks Juwelen: die zum UNESCO-Weltkulturerbe gehörende Altstadt und Stadtmauer - auf diesem 3-stündigen Rundgang mit einem fachkundigen Stadtführer. Die Tour beginnt mit einem geführten Spaziergang durch das Zentrum der Altstadt. Weiter geht es über die Promenade. Bewundern Sie berühmte Sehenswürdigkeiten wie den Sponza-Palast, bevor Sie in ein Labyrinth von Nebenstraßen abtauchen, die voll gepackt sind mit hübschen Lokalen, Geschäften und einer Vielzahl architektionischer Schätze. Anschließend geht es weiter zu der bekannten Stadtmauer. Genießen Sie wundervolle Aussichten auf die Altstadt und die Adria während Sie mit Ihrem Reiseführer die gesamte Länge der Mauer ablaufen.

- GEHENDE INFO
- Die Tour beinhaltet anstrengende Wanderungen.
- In Dubrovnik müssen die Gäste etwa 1000 Meter über Kopfsteinpflaster und flaches Gelände laufen und bis zu 150 Stufen nehmen.
- Der Museums-Multipass beinhaltet den Eintritt in die folgenden Museen in Dubrovnik: Kulturhistorisches Museum, Rektorenpalast; Schifffahrtsmuseum; Ethnographisches Museum; Archäologische Ausstellungen Fort Revelin; Haus von Marin Držić; Museum für moderne Kunst Dubrovnik; Naturhistorisches Museum Dubrovnik; Dulčić-Masle-Pulitika-Galerie; Das Pulitika Studio.
